#fan-petition

[ follow ]
National Football League
fromMusket Fire
22 hours ago

Patriots fans just got 40,000 reasons to laugh at the Bills' dysfunction

Buffalo fired Sean McDermott after nine seasons; fans erupted, launching a petition exceeding 40,000 signatures amid criticism of owner Terry Pegula and GM Brandon Beane.
[ Load more ]